Transaction 6ecdf75bc6599b149caf15d50d528d7519289f0fab63072cd410594cd4f3b062
1 Input
1 Output
-
6ecdf75bc6599b149caf15d50d528d7519289f0fab63072cd410594cd4f3b062:0
- value
- 509243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3165dc86b6bc83057e0f475f3f558148c033240 OP_EQUAL
- address
- 3KUYUzSd7w3jUE8s4G3RJUNKoySd9x8uGP